Guides
to Protecting Your Health Care Privacy
- Citizens'
Council on Health Care
A non-profit consumer privacy advocacy group, this
organization provides information on such issues
as medical confidentiality strategies, government
surveillance, immunization registries, government
smart cards, and much more.
- Electronic Privacy
Information Center (EPIC)
A public interest research center in Washington,
DC established in 1994 to "focus public attention
on emerging civil liberties issues and to protect
privacy, the First Amendment, and constitutional
values." The section on Medical
Record Privacy is especially good.
- Health
Privacy Project
The best site for information on health privacy,
covering both state and federal legislation, analysis
of late-breaking news, and links to patient rights
groups, federal agencies, industry and provider
groups and state resources. Sponsored by the Institute
for Health Care Research and Policy.
- HIPAAdvisory
and Department
of Health and Human Services HIPAA Site are
two good sources to begin understanding the complex
issues involved in the Health Insurance Portability
and Accountability Act of 1996 (HIPAA) which calls
for standardization of electronic patient health,
administrative and financial data; unique health
identifiers for individuals, employers, health plans
and health care providers; security standards protecting
the confidentiality and integrity of individually
identifiable health information, past, present or
future.
